Few roofing problems are more frustrating than seeing water return after a previous repair. Once a leak has been addressed, it is reasonable to expect the affected area to remain dry. However, when damp staining reappears or water begins entering during heavy rainfall, it does not automatically mean that the earlier repair has failed.
Roof leaks can be deceptive. Water may enter through one part of the roof before travelling beneath tiles, along underlay or across structural components and becoming visible somewhere else. In other cases, the original repair remains sound while an adjoining section of ageing roofing develops a new weakness.

Why Can a Roof Start Leaking Again After It Has Already Been Repaired?
A recurring leak needs to be approached as a fresh diagnostic problem. Previous repairs provide useful information, but the current source of water still needs to be established.
Sometimes an earlier repair did not address the true cause. In other situations, it successfully resolved the original defect but deterioration has since developed elsewhere. If a roof has several ageing components, repeated water ingress can also indicate that the problem is becoming broader than one isolated weakness.
The Original Repair May Still Be Completely Sound
When dampness returns in approximately the same internal location, homeowners naturally tend to suspect the previous repair.
However, the repaired area may still be performing correctly.
Water entering further up a pitched roof can travel beneath the covering before reaching the interior. A new defect can therefore produce dampness close to an old leak even though the two problems have different external causes.
This is why previous repair areas should be inspected, but they should not automatically be assumed to be responsible.
The Original Source May Have Been Misidentified
Finding the true source of a roof leak is not always straightforward.
The internal position of a ceiling stain does not necessarily correspond with the external entry point. Water can travel considerable distances before it becomes visible, particularly on pitched roofs with several junctions and concealed layers.
If an earlier repair concentrated on the area directly above the visible dampness without confirming how water was entering, the actual weakness may have remained untreated.
A professional inspection should therefore trace the likely route of moisture rather than simply focus on the previous repair.
Another Roofing Component May Have Deteriorated
A roof is made up of several components that work together to provide weather protection.
Tiles or slates, flashing, valleys, ridges, verges and junctions can all deteriorate at different rates. Correcting one component does not prevent another ageing area from developing a problem later.
For example, a previous tile repair may remain perfectly secure while deterioration develops around nearby flashing.
Where leaks recur, assessing the surrounding roof provides a clearer picture than repeatedly concentrating on one historic defect.
Water Can Travel Before It Becomes Visible
One of the main reasons recurring roof leaks are difficult to diagnose is the way water behaves after penetrating the outer covering.
Moisture does not necessarily fall vertically into the room below. It can follow roof timbers, underlay and other surfaces before reaching a point where it becomes visible.
This means a stain can appear several times in the same location even when water has entered through different external weaknesses.
The visible damp patch should therefore be treated as evidence of water ingress, not as a precise map of where the roof requires repair.
Certain Leaks Only Appear During Particular Weather Conditions
Some roofing weaknesses become noticeable only when rainfall arrives from a particular direction.
Ordinary rainfall may be shed successfully, while wind-driven rain reaches a vulnerable junction, displaced tile or deteriorating flashing detail from a different angle. Prolonged rainfall can also expose weaknesses that remain unnoticed during short showers.
This can make a recurring leak appear unpredictable.
Noting when the leak occurs can provide valuable information during an inspection and help determine which parts of the roof require closer attention.
A Small Defect May Have Developed Beside the Previous Repair
A properly repaired section can sometimes remain stronger than the ageing materials around it.
As surrounding roofing continues to weather, a new weakness may develop immediately beside the repair. From inside the property, the resulting water ingress may look almost identical to the original problem.
This situation becomes more common when the existing roof has several areas approaching a similar stage of deterioration.
Inspecting both the repair and neighbouring materials helps establish whether the latest leak represents a new localised defect.
Flashing Can Be Responsible for Persistent Water Ingress
Flashing protects vulnerable roof junctions where different materials or surfaces meet.
If flashing becomes displaced, cracked or otherwise unable to perform effectively, water can penetrate through relatively small openings. These defects are not always obvious from ground level and can sometimes produce intermittent leaks rather than constant water ingress.
Where previous repairs have concentrated primarily on tiles or slates, nearby flashing should also be considered.
A successful repair depends on identifying the component actually allowing water through.
Valleys Can Create Difficult-to-Trace Leaks
Roof valleys carry significant volumes of rainwater because they collect water from adjoining slopes.
Deterioration within a valley or the surrounding roofing can therefore cause leaks that become particularly noticeable during prolonged rainfall. Water may also travel away from the original defect before appearing internally.
Repeated problems around a valley should be assessed as a complete detail rather than treated as a series of unrelated surface defects.
This allows the condition of the valley and adjoining roofing materials to be considered together.
Previous Temporary Repairs May No Longer Be Performing
Not every historic roof repair was necessarily intended to provide the same type of long-term solution.
A roof may contain old patches, sealants or other localised treatments applied at different times. As these areas weather, they can become less dependable.
Adding another layer of repair material without understanding the construction underneath can make future diagnosis more difficult.
Where several historic interventions are present, it can be useful to establish which repairs remain sound and which areas require a more appropriate reconstruction. Poor or repeated repairs can sometimes obscure the original cause of water ingress rather than resolving it.
Recurring Leaks Can Indicate Wider Roof Deterioration
One returning leak does not automatically mean that the whole roof is deteriorating.
However, the situation deserves broader consideration when leaks occur repeatedly in different areas, roofing materials are visibly deteriorating or new problems continue appearing after successful local repairs.
At this stage, treating each defect independently may provide an incomplete picture.
A whole-roof assessment can establish whether there is one difficult localised problem or whether several components are beginning to decline together.
Repeated Repairs Should Be Considered as a Pattern
The history of a roof can provide useful diagnostic information.
An occasional repair is normal and does not necessarily indicate poor overall condition. The significance changes when a roof requires attention increasingly frequently.
If previous repairs remain sound but new defects continually appear elsewhere, the problem may be the condition of the remaining original roofing rather than any individual repair.
Looking at the pattern of work over time can therefore help determine whether another targeted repair remains appropriate.
Why Simply Repairing the Same Area Again Can Be a Mistake
When water returns, repeating the previous repair may seem like the obvious response.
However, doing so without confirming the current source can result in work being carried out on a section that is already sound. The actual entry point may then remain untouched.
A better approach is to begin again with diagnosis.
The previous repair should be examined, but so should the surrounding roof, relevant junctions and other possible routes of water ingress.
When Is Another Localised Repair Appropriate?
Recurring water ingress does not automatically mean extensive roofing work is necessary.
A professional inspection may identify a new but clearly localised defect within a roof that otherwise remains in dependable condition. In that situation, targeted repair can still be an appropriate solution.
The important distinction is whether the defect is genuinely isolated.
Confirming the wider roof remains sound provides greater confidence that repairing the identified weakness will restore reliable weather protection.
When Should the Wider Roof Be Investigated?
A more comprehensive assessment becomes valuable when there are signs that the problem extends beyond one repair area.
This may include recurring leaks in different locations, several previous repairs, deteriorating tiles or slates, weaknesses across multiple roof details, or water ingress that continues despite apparently successful local work.
The purpose of assessing the wider roof is not to assume that extensive work is required. It is to understand whether individual defects are connected before deciding what should be repaired.
Accurate Leak Detection Helps Avoid Treating the Wrong Problem
The quality of a roof repair depends heavily on the accuracy of the diagnosis that comes before it.
A visible internal stain confirms that moisture is reaching the property, but it does not identify precisely where the roof has failed. Examining the covering, junctions, previous repairs and surrounding materials helps build a more complete picture.
This approach reduces the risk of repeatedly treating symptoms while leaving the actual source of water ingress unresolved.

Conclusion
When water returns after a previous roof repair, it does not necessarily mean that the original work has failed. The leak may originate from another part of the roof, surrounding materials may have deteriorated, or water may be travelling before becoming visible internally.
The most important step is therefore to identify the current source of water ingress before carrying out further repairs. Where problems are recurring, the surrounding roof should also be assessed to determine whether the latest leak is isolated or part of broader deterioration.
